Getting There
-
Car
If you are traveling by car, set your GPS to the coordinates 45.7983397, 24.1508158. From the Sibiu Area, head towards the city center. Follow the signs to the Old Town, which is easily accessible via the main road. Parking is available at several locations around the Old Town; however, be aware that some areas may require payment, typically around 5 RON per hour. Look for parking signs indicating 'Parcare' and pay at the machines.
-
Public Transportation
To reach Old Town via public transportation, you can take a bus to the 'Piata Mare' stop, which is a short walk from Old Town. Buses operate frequently from various locations in the Sibiu Area. A single ticket costs around 2 RON and can be purchased from ticket machines or on the bus. Once at 'Piata Mare', walk towards the historical center, following the signs pointing to the Old Town.
-
Walking
If you're already in the Sibiu Area and prefer to walk, the Old Town is a beautiful stroll away. From the city center, head towards the 'Brukenthal Palace' and follow the signs to 'Piata Mare'. The Old Town is pedestrian-friendly, and you can enjoy various shops and cafes along the way.
-
Taxi
For a more direct route, consider taking a taxi. Taxis are readily available throughout the Sibiu Area. The fare to Old Town should be around 10-15 RON, depending on your starting point. Make sure to choose a licensed taxi service to avoid overcharging.
